nopeair Posted March 31, 2011 Share Posted March 31, 2011 Recently I decided to install SL on my notebook Extensa 7620G. Intel Core2 Duo T5450 1.66 GHzIntel PM965 Express Chipset DDR2 2GB RAM memory ATI Mobility Radeon HD 2400 XT Intel PRO/Wireless 3945ABG First I tried iAtkos S3 10.6.3 ver.2, after booting using Empire EFI installation hangs with message "Still waiting for root device". Google tells me that this was problem with HDD drivers so I decided to try some another build. Next one was Mac OS X Snow Leopard Universal v3.6 (10.6.2) - it booted normally, but after entering screen with Apple logo after few seconds appeared pop-up saying "You need to restart your computer now" on different languages. This message appears again and again after every reboot. At that point Google didn't actually helped me - there were a lot of advice's to change some parameters in BIOS (but I don't have such parameters at all), etc. Can someone please help me with this issue or recommend some another assembly to install. Bootflags, try these: platform=X86PC -v platform=ACPI -v -x -v -f -v try this as well: http://www.insanelymac.com/forum/index.php?showtopic=135178 Still waiting for root device is a pain in the neck to bypass, because it's a strange error, that can be caused be different things.
